DeleteModificationStoredProcedureConfiguration<TEntityType>.Navigation Metoda
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Przeciążenia
| Navigation<TPrincipalEntityType>(Expression<Func<TPrincipalEntityType, ICollection<TEntityType>>>, Action<A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>>) |
Konfiguruje parametry dla relacji, w której właściwość klucza obcego nie jest uwzględniona w klasie. |
| Navigation<TPrincipalEntityType>(Expression<Func<TPrincipalEntityType, TEntityType>>, Action<A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>>) |
Konfiguruje parametry dla relacji, w której właściwość klucza obcego nie jest uwzględniona w klasie. |
Navigation<TPrincipalEntityType>(Expression<Func<TPrincipalEntityType, ICollection<TEntityType>>>, Action<A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>>)
Konfiguruje parametry dla relacji, w której właściwość klucza obcego nie jest uwzględniona w klasie.
[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Design", "CA1006:DoNotNestGenericTypesInMemberSignatures")]
public System.Data.Entity.ModelConfiguration.Configuration.DeleteModificationStoredProcedureConfiguration<TEntityType> Navigation<TPrincipalEntityType>(System.Linq.Expressions.Expression<Func<TPrincipalEntityType,System.Collections.Generic.ICollection<TEntityType>>> navigationPropertyExpression, Action<System.Data.Entity.ModelConfiguration.Configuration.A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>> associationModificationStoredProcedureConfigurationAction) where TPrincipalEntityType : class;
member this.Navigation : System.Linq.Expressions.Expression<Func<'PrincipalEntityType, System.Collections.Generic.ICollection<'EntityType>>> * Action<System.Data.Entity.ModelConfiguration.Configuration.AssociationModificationStoredProcedureConfiguration<'PrincipalEntityType>> -> System.Data.Entity.ModelConfiguration.Configuration.DeleteModificationStoredProcedureConfiguration<'EntityType (requires 'EntityType : null)> (requires 'PrincipalEntityType : null)
Public Function Navigation(Of TPrincipalEntityType As Class) (navigationPropertyExpression As Expression(Of Func(Of TPrincipalEntityType, ICollection(Of TEntityType))), associationModificationStoredProcedureConfigurationAction As Action(Of AssociationModificationStoredProcedureConfiguration(Of TPrincipalEntityType))) As DeleteModificationStoredProcedureConfiguration(Of TEntityType)
Parametry typu
- TPrincipalEntityType
Typ jednostki głównej w relacji.
Parametry
- navigationPropertyExpression
- Expression<Func<TPrincipalEntityType,ICollection<TEntityType>>>
Wyrażenie lambda reprezentujące właściwość nawigacji dla relacji. C#: t => t.MyProperty VB.Net: Function(t) t.MyProperty
- associationModificationStoredProcedureConfigurationAction
- Action<A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>>
Wyrażenie lambda, które wykonuje konfigurację.
Zwraca
To samo wystąpienie konfiguracji, dzięki czemu można połączyć wiele wywołań.
- Atrybuty
Dotyczy
Navigation<TPrincipalEntityType>(Expression<Func<TPrincipalEntityType, TEntityType>>, Action<A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>>)
Konfiguruje parametry dla relacji, w której właściwość klucza obcego nie jest uwzględniona w klasie.
[System.Diagnostics.CodeAnalysis.SuppressMessage("Microsoft.Design", "CA1006:DoNotNestGenericTypesInMemberSignatures")]
public System.Data.Entity.ModelConfiguration.Configuration.DeleteModificationStoredProcedureConfiguration<TEntityType> Navigation<TPrincipalEntityType>(System.Linq.Expressions.Expression<Func<TPrincipalEntityType,TEntityType>> navigationPropertyExpression, Action<System.Data.Entity.ModelConfiguration.Configuration.A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>> associationModificationStoredProcedureConfigurationAction) where TPrincipalEntityType : class;
member this.Navigation : System.Linq.Expressions.Expression<Func<'PrincipalEntityType, 'EntityType>> * Action<System.Data.Entity.ModelConfiguration.Configuration.AssociationModificationStoredProcedureConfiguration<'PrincipalEntityType>> -> System.Data.Entity.ModelConfiguration.Configuration.DeleteModificationStoredProcedureConfiguration<'EntityType (requires 'EntityType : null)> (requires 'PrincipalEntityType : null)
Public Function Navigation(Of TPrincipalEntityType As Class) (navigationPropertyExpression As Expression(Of Func(Of TPrincipalEntityType, TEntityType)), associationModificationStoredProcedureConfigurationAction As Action(Of AssociationModificationStoredProcedureConfiguration(Of TPrincipalEntityType))) As DeleteModificationStoredProcedureConfiguration(Of TEntityType)
Parametry typu
- TPrincipalEntityType
Typ jednostki głównej w relacji.
Parametry
- navigationPropertyExpression
- Expression<Func<TPrincipalEntityType,TEntityType>>
Wyrażenie lambda reprezentujące właściwość nawigacji dla relacji. C#: t => t.MyProperty VB.Net: Function(t) t.MyProperty
- associationModificationStoredProcedureConfigurationAction
- Action<AssociationModificationStoredProcedureConfiguration<TPrincipalEntityType>>
Wyrażenie lambda, które wykonuje konfigurację.
Zwraca
To samo wystąpienie konfiguracji, dzięki czemu można połączyć wiele wywołań.
- Atrybuty